Sign up freeChristine Jane Franke 1539–1592 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1539
Birth Location: Terling, Essex, England
Death Date: 20 Jun 1592
Death Location: Fairsted, Essex, England
Father: Richard Franke
Mother: Alice Kente
Spouse(s): John Orvice
Children(s): Elizabeth Orvice
In 1539, Christine Jane Franke entered the world in Terling, Essex, England, born to Richard Rich Franke And Alice Kente. Christine Jane Franke married John Orvice, and had children including Elizabeth Orvice. Christine Jane Franke passed away in 1592 in Fairsted, Essex, England.
